Russian Troops Enter Seversk’s City Center in Critical Push for Donbass Stronghold – Late-Breaking Update

Russian troops have entered the city center of Seversk in the Donetsk People’s Republic, according to a report from the Telegram channel ‘Operation Z: Military Correspondents of the Russian Spring’ (RusVesna).

The channel described how the Russian army breached Seversk from the south, initiating a push toward the city’s core, which is considered a critical stronghold for Ukrainian forces in the Donbass region.

By evening, a video surfaced capturing a Russian shock group already positioned in the city center, marking a significant tactical shift in the ongoing conflict.

The publication released a detailed map illustrating the advancing Russian forces, showing troops moving through the southern part of Seversk.

Simultaneously, additional units were reported advancing from the north, originating near Dronovka.

To the east of Seversk, Russian soldiers reportedly launched assaults on several Ukrainian military positions located within woodland areas, further tightening the encirclement of the city.

On November 17, the Russian Ministry of Defense announced that its forces had captured control of Dvurechanske in the Kharkiv region, Platovka in the Donetsk People’s Republic, and Guy in the Dnipropetrovsk region within a single day.

This rapid territorial gain underscores the scale of Russian operations across multiple fronts.

The ministry emphasized that securing Platovka would grant Russian troops complete control over the strategic road connecting Severodonnsk to Red Limans, a development that could significantly disrupt Ukrainian logistics and defensive coordination.

Earlier, an expert analysis highlighted the precarious situation on the outskirts of Seversk, noting the vulnerability of Ukrainian positions as Russian forces converged from multiple directions.

The combination of simultaneous advances from the south, north, and east suggests a coordinated effort to isolate and overwhelm the city, potentially leading to a swift capture of Seversk and further consolidation of Russian control in the region.
